It's that time of year again. Our dining room table has been transformed into my very amateur little green house.
I'm trying my hand at flowers this year though. I'm still going to do some veggies, but only the ones that did well last year or at the very least, that I know what to change to improve them this year.
I want to get some color in our yard and fill in some of the space in the backyard. It's just too bare for my tastes.
And since I absolutely love spring, I'm going to try to cut some costs of buying the plants by having them already blooming in our house before planting time.
The ones I'm working on right now are Jaguar Marigolds, Fruit Smoothie Zinnia, Red Velvet Celosia and some yellow Calla Lillies.
I'm excited again to watch my plants grow!
